> On Tue, Nov 26, 2013 at 04:33:35PM -0800, Sam Roberts wrote:
>> So, I use vi keys in copy mode, so I can do selection with C-b[, then
>> select with " ", move around "ENTER"...
>>
>> Works ok, but I rarely paste from my shell history into tmux.... and
>> if I'm copying from/to vim, I use "+y.
>>
>> Mostly, I copy history out into github comments, jira, skype, etc.
>> I've searched around, and I've seen various approaches to selecting,
>> then copying the selection into xclip, but what I'd like is for EVERY
>> selection I make to be available in the x11 clipboard.
>>
>> Is there any way to do this? I hoped:
>>
>> set-option set-clipboard on
>>
>> would do it, but it did not.
>>
>> I use tmux v1.8, on xubuntu 13.10, FYI.
